Platypuses teach finances
OTP Bank and the Fáy András Foundation have developed a phone game that teaches young people in a fun way how to manage their finances. The mobile game is called Platypus: A FinLit Story and it can be downloaded for free. Its two main characters are the two young platypuses Cash and Flow, who speak in the voices of pop singer Heni Dér and radio show host Cooky. While playing the game, users can collect sushi that they can use in bidding for valuable prizes at www.platypus.hu, such as smartphones, scooters and game consoles.
